17 ROYAL GROVE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the County Durham local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 17 ROYAL GROVE sales between September 2003 and February 2019 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2007 sale was for 10%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 10% below the HPI over time, until the February 2019 sale, where it rises to 7%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 7% above the HPI.

What might 17 ROYAL GROVE be worth now?

17 ROYAL GROVE might now be worth an estimated £251,892.

This is based on house price inflation of 41.9%, between February 2019 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the County Durham local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 41.9%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 17 ROYAL GROVE of £177,500 on 21st February 2019. For the value to have increased from £177,500 to £251,892 over the six years to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 17 ROYAL GROVE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the County Durham local authority area.
  • The February 2019 sale price of £177,500 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 17 ROYAL GROVE has not materially changed since February 2019.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
